I applied through a recruiter. I interviewed at Citadel in Nov 2020
Interview
Phone screen, 1 technical phone interview, 3 technical Zoom interviews, 1 behavioral/case interview with sector data analyst, and 1 behavioral/technical interview with senior director. The onsite interviews were essentially replaced by the last 3 interviews specified above. Overall, the company takes a long time to get back to you between each round (minimum two weeks). The questions were generally split pretty evenly between Python and SQL and they really dive into the work you've done in your previous role.
Interview questions [1]
Question 1
-Lock combination BFS problem
-Find files in a file system DFS problem
I applied through a staffing agency. The process took 1 week. I interviewed at Citadel (New York, NY) in Apr 2025
Interview
Head hunter reached out to me. I was set up with an internal recruiter to speak about scheduling and the process. Did an initial code assessment with a current employee. Interview processed ended there.
Interview questions [1]
Question 1
Write a python class that handles permissions and can be updated with a config file.
First there was an at home assessment, passing that there was a coder pad interview, and finally a full-day interview with multiple interviewers, various coder pad-style assessments, technical questions, and personality fit.
Interview questions [1]
Question 1
How would you map a function across multiple machines?